Output 24f6813344e0f82620ec5c7bab327dd3e168871d262b23473db2707624339750:4

value
88900
script pubkey
OP_0 OP_PUSHBYTES_20 50a9a7ebcc50b14eb06c76137a0eae8f9ee038bc
address
bc1q2z56067v2zc5avrvwcfh5r4w370wqw9u8t0d59
transaction
24f6813344e0f82620ec5c7bab327dd3e168871d262b23473db2707624339750
spent
true